Meet Baby — a 9 year old, 4 lb Chihuahua mix with a heart as soft as his tiny little snuggles. Quick Facts: Name: Baby Breed: Chihuahua Mix Age: 9 years old Weight: 4 lbs. House-Trained: Working on it! Crate-Trained: Yes Good with Dogs: Yes Good with Cats: Not yet tested but would likely do well Good with Kids: Yes! Energy Level: Low (cuddly couch potato) Fence Required: No Special Needs: Baby has a collapsing trachea and will need to be monitored regularly for the rest of his life. He is currently on Stanozolol 0.5 mg capsules which is a compounded anabolic steroid and will need this medication for the rest of his life. He does extremely well when on this medicated regime and doesn't let his health get him down! The medication costs between $68-$80 per month. The rescue is monitoring Baby and if he has any breathing changes or coughing we will reevaluate his medication and additional steroids may be introduced. About Baby’s Breed: Our best guess is that Baby is a Chihuahua mixed breed. Chihuahuas are tiny dogs with big, confident personalities. They’re known for being spirited, loyal, and deeply attached to their people, often forming strong one on one bonds. Despite their small size, they’re bold, alert, and full of character, with an affectionate nature that makes them wonderful companion dogs. An ideal home for a Chihuahua is one that offers gentle handling, companionship, and a calm environment. Because they bond closely and can be sensitive, they thrive with adults or families who understand their strong willed, expressive nature and can provide consistent, positive training. They love being close to their person, enjoy short walks, and do well in homes where they can feel safe, loved, and included. What to Love about Baby: Baby is the definition of a lap dog.
